Delicious Pumpkin Walnut Muffin Recipe Ingredients:

1 C Whole wheat flour
1 C AP flour
¼ tsp Baking soda
1 tsp Baking powder
½ C Brown sugar
1 tsp Salt
1 ½ tsp Pumpkin Spice
¼ C Oil
¼ C Applesauce
¾ C Pumpkin puree
1/3 C Milk
2 Eggs, whisked

Delicious Pumpkin Walnut Muffin Recipe Directions

Preheat the oven to 350 and grease or line muffin tins.
1. Mix all dry ingredients together
2. Mix all wet ingredients together
3. Mix the wet ingredients into the dry until just combined
4. Add in the walnuts, fold in without mixing too much.
5. Fill muffin wells to 2/3 full
6.  Bake at 350 for 30 – 35 minutes or until an inserted toothpick comes out clean.
